About the Roles:
The Vice President, Business Development will report to the Chief Strategy and Growth Officer. This individual will be responsible for helping to design, structure, and execute Evolent’s growth path. This person will be focused on new partnerships, go-to-market sales, business development, and cross-selling. As a highly externally facing role, this person must exude an energetic, strong executive presence and have a mission driven mentality to succeed in this role.
What you’ll be doing:
Responsible for driving new logo sales and current partnership expansions at national and regional payer or health system and oncology provider group targets, with accountability to Evolent leadership for top-line bookings
Provide leadership and mentorship to the business development team, fostering a high-performance culture
Demonstrate the ability to organize a sales enablement portfolio, including tools, processes, and development activities to ensure the in-market team is differentiated through content knowledge and proficiency
Personally initiate and foster executive level relationships at managed care organizations or health systems and large provider groups
Collaborate with internal teams, including marketing, product development, and operations, to support business growth initiatives
Oversee an end-to-end new customer acquisition process, from pitch to opportunity sizing, pricing, diligence, partner development, and contracting
Lead top-of-funnel lead-gen activities, including: conference strategy, channel partnerships, cold outreach, market-specific campaigns, etc.
Ensure tight discipline of sales operations: reporting/analytics, Salesforce.com utilization, quarterly KPI targets
Channel customer feedback from the market to systematically inform marketing, product, and operational counterparts across the company
Refine product messaging to ensure strong product-market fit alignment
Desired Skill Set:
Advanced degree (e.g., MBA) or equivalent relevant experience
10+ years of experience in business development, sales, or strategic partnerships within healthcare
Proven track record of accomplishment on execution of population health, value-based care, clinical quality and clinical operation initiatives within a progressive and forward-thinking health care organization
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, adept at navigating senior-level stakeholder discussions
Experience and proven success with complex, multi-million-dollar enterprise sales
Knowledge of the managed care and provider markets (both payers and risk-bearing organizations)
Passion for healthcare and subscribed to the vision of value-based care
Strong familiarity with risk-based contracting
Thrives in an entrepreneurial, fast-paced environment with a collaborative and innovation-driven culture
Travel Requirements: Willing to travel twice a month for meetings, site visits, and partnership engagements
